Between the Lines

Between the Lines specializes in creative and inspiring non-fiction. Our readers look to BTL for challenging ideas, concepts and analysis not readily found in the mainstream. Our wide-ranging books embrace critical perspectives on social issues, politics and public policy issues, development studies, history, education, the environment, health, gender and sexuality, labour, technology, media and culture.
